PHX

I ultimately gave up on PHX and changed to a different domicile. It was just too expensive for mediocre hotels.

Crown Plaza - $111 per night out the door
Pros:
- SkyTrain to 44th street station and walk across the street
- Right next to light rail and bus stop. Easy public transportation to Target, restaurants, Tempe bars etc
- Panera, Burger King across the street
- Cancellation as late as 6pm same day

Cons:
- Dank, dark, depressing
- Really poor hotel restaurant

Residence Inn: $95/ night out the door
Pros:
- Bonvoy points
- Free breakfast
- Kitchenette
- Bus stop next door

Cons:
- No shuttle (uses Lyft)
- Further from light rail
- No restaurant for lunch / dinner
